In this tutorial, the presenter demonstrates how to hide placeholder text in content control form fields, which appears as light gray to prompt users for input. The video begins by explaining that sometimes this placeholder text is undesirable. To hide it, the presenter uses a form created with plain text content controls. By entering design mode, they highlight the placeholder text, ensuring to include the period, then right-click and select "Font." In the font options, they check the "Hidden" box under font effects to conceal the placeholder text. Viewers are encouraged to explore the playlist on creating fillable forms for further guidance.

The defines a hidden input field. A hidden field lets web developers include data that cannot be seen or modified by users when a form is submitted. A hidden field often stores what database record that needs to be updated when the form is submitted.

In your envelope or template, place a text field on your document. Select the text field to open the properties panel. Expand the Formatting section. Mark the formatting option Hide text with asterisks.
Using the style. It can have values like block, inline, inline-block, etc., but the value used to hide an element is none. Using JavaScript, we set the style. display property value to none to hide html element.
